Tour

De SupraWiki

Predefinição:Velocity

  1. set ($columnsProperties = {
 'doc.title': {"type": "text", "size":10,"link":"view"},
 'isActive': {"type": "text", "size":10, "sortable":true, "filterable": false},
 'targetPage': {"type":"text","size":10},
 'targetClass': {"type":"text","size":10},
 '_actions': {"sortable":false,"filterable":false,"html":true,"actions":["edit","delete"]}

})

  1. set ($options = {
 'className': 'TourCode.TourClass',
 'resultPage': 'TourCode.TourLiveTableResults',
 'translationPrefix': 'tour.livetable.',
 'tagCloud': true,
 'rowCount': 15,
 'maxPages': 10,
 'selectedColumn': 'doc.title',
 'defaultOrder': 'asc',
 'queryFilters': 'currentlanguage'

})

  1. set ($columns = ['doc.title', 'isActive', 'targetPage'])
  2. if ($isAdvancedUser)
 #set ($discard = $columns.add('targetClass'))
  1. end
  2. set ($discard = $columns.add('_actions'))
  3. livetable('tour' $columns $columnsProperties $options)

Predefinição:/velocity